redis高并发架构与底层原理 redis高并发消息

导读:Redis是一款高性能的内存数据库,其支持高并发消息处理 。本文将从以下几个方面介绍Redis高并发消息的实现 。
1. Redis发布/订阅模式
Redis发布/订阅模式是一种简单而有效的消息传递机制 。在该模式下,发布者将消息发送到指定频道,订阅者可以选择订阅感兴趣的频道,并接收来自该频道的消息 。
2. Redis列表数据结构
【redis高并发架构与底层原理 redis高并发消息】Redis的列表数据结构支持双向链表 , 可以快速地添加、删除和获取元素 。这使得Redis成为了一个非常适合处理队列和任务的工具 。
3. Redis事务
Redis事务提供了一种原子化的操作方式,可以保证多个命令的执行顺序和结果的一致性 。通过使用Redis事务,我们可以轻松地实现高并发消息处理 。
总结:Redis作为一款高性能的内存数据库,其在高并发消息处理方面具有很大的优势 。通过Redis发布/订阅模式、列表数据结构和事务等特性,我们可以轻松地实现高效、可靠的消息传递系统 。

    推荐阅读